Birmingham boss McLeish warns players about fired-up Liverpool
Birmingham City boss Alex McLeish has warned his players to expect a fired-up Liverpool when the two teams meet at Anfield tonight.
With the spotlight firmly pointed at Reds boss Rafael Benitez and his players to produce a much-improved performance, McLeish is wary that the home side will be desperate to give their fans something to cheer about and help get their season back on track.
“Liverpool fans, I think, are still very supportive of Rafa Benitez so there could be a backlash,” said McLeish.
“There are some great arenas throughout the world and Anfield is one of them. We are living in a knee-jerk and blame culture and have done for a few years.
“But I think it is tremendous the Liverpool fans have stayed loyal to Rafa.”
McLeish added that although Benitez is under fire, his own club is experiencing some difficulty at the present time.
“Rafa might have problems but I have problems too,” added McLeish.
“It is not as if we are on an even playing field with them going to Anfield. They will still be big favourites to beat Birmingham City.
“Our mission is to play as well as we did at Old Trafford, Tottenham and the Emirates this season - but this time comeback with something to show for our efforts.”
